Overseas students should complete formalities swiftly PDF Print E-mail
The College would like to remind all it’s overseas applicants who are interested in applying for the forthcoming the Jan’10 intake that they have just a few weeks to complete all their formalities. Those students that need to apply for their UK student visas should note that during December, the British Embassy staff will be going on leave and the Embassies will be shut for several days. In January, the Embassies are likely to see a massive pile of student visa applications coming in and we expect these could be subject to delays. We would therefore advise all our applicants to lodge their visa applications by late November. Candidates that need to complete their admission formalities with the College should do so without delay. The College will itself be shutting for the Christmas break on 18th December and will re-open in early January. There will be no admission processing during this period.
